Alzheimer's, Dementia Care to Cost U.S. $200 Billion This Year

Thursday, March 8th, 2012

THURSDAY, March 8 (HealthDay News) — Caring for people with Alzheimer's disease and other types of dementia will cost the United States about $200 billion this year, a total that includes $140 billion paid by Medicare and Medicaid, new statistics released Thursday show.

Alzheimer’s research funding difficult to come by

Thursday, December 29th, 2011

  Alzheimer’s is the sixth leading cause of death in the United States. More Americans each year die from Alzheimer’s than breast or prostate cancer combined.
